Last year it was a major issue as people got robbed walking and looking at their cell phones. Albert and I parked a UTV on the main sidewalk awhile back, we noticed several people walking on the sidewalk towards us looking at their phones. We sat there for about 15 to 20 minutes, while we were sitting there three different people almost walked straight into the UTV and probably would have if Officer Albert and I didn't say anything. Our intention wasn't to get someone hurt, or really anything other than to park the UTV as the sidewalk is rather wide. But after watching the first person almost walk into the UTV we thought we would sit there a little longer. This was during broad day light and people were almost walking into a parked UTV, how bad is this at night?
